Cvičení – vyčištění prostředí Azure DevOps

Dokončeno

Dokončili jste úkoly pro tento modul. V této části vyčistíte prostředky Azure, přesunete pracovní položku do stavu Hotovo v Azure Boards a vyčistíte prostředí Azure DevOps.

Důležité

Tato stránka obsahuje důležité kroky pro vyčištění. Vyčištěním pomůžete zajistit, abyste nevyčerpali bezplatné minuty sestavení. Pomůže vám také zajistit, abyste po dokončení tohoto modulu neúčtovaly poplatky za prostředky Azure.

Vyčištění prostředků Azure

Tady odstraníte instance služby Aplikace Azure a Azure Functions. Nejjednodušší způsob, jak odstranit instance, je odstranit jejich nadřazenou skupinu prostředků. Když odstraníte skupinu prostředků, odstraníte všechny prostředky v této skupině.

V modulu Vytvoření kanálu verze pomocí azure Pipelines jste spravované prostředky Azure prostřednictvím webu Azure Portal. V této části nasazení pomocí Azure CLI pomocí Azure Cloud Shellu vypnete. Postup je podobný krokům, které jste použili při vytváření prostředků.

Vyčištění skupiny prostředků:

  1. Přejděte na web Azure Portal a přihlaste se.

  2. V řádku nabídek vyberte Cloud Shell. Po zobrazení výzvy vyberte prostředí Bash .

    A screenshot of the Azure portal showing the location of the Cloud Shell menu item.

  3. Spuštěním následujícího az group delete příkazu odstraňte tailspin-space-game-rgpoužitou skupinu prostředků .

    az group delete --name tailspin-space-game-rg
    

    Po zobrazení výzvy zadejte y potvrzení operace.

  4. Jako volitelný krok spusťte po dokončení předchozího příkazu následující az group list příkaz.

    az group list --output table
    

    Uvidíte, že skupina tailspin-space-game-rg prostředků již neexistuje.

Přesunutí pracovní položky do stavu Hotovo

Tady přesunete pracovní položku, kterou jste přiřadili sami sobě dříve v tomto modulu. Rozhraní API tabulky výsledků refaktorování přesunete jako aplikaci Azure Functions do sloupce Hotovo .

V praxi "Hotovo" často znamená uvedení funkčního softwaru do rukou uživatelů. Pro účely výuky zde označíte tuto práci jako hotovou, protože jste splnili cíl pro tým Tailspin. Chtěli refaktorovat svůj projekt tak, aby extrahovali rozhraní API tabulky výsledků jako aplikaci funkcí.

Na konci každého sprintu nebo iterace práce můžete vy a váš tým uspořádat retrospektivní schůzku. Na schůzce sdílejte práci, kterou jste dokončili, co proběhlo dobře a co můžete zlepšit.

Nastavení dokončení pracovní položky:

  1. V Azure DevOps přejděte na Boards a pak v nabídce vyberte Boards .

  2. Přesuňte rozhraní API tabulky výsledků refaktoringu jako pracovní položku aplikace Azure Functions ze sloupce Probíhá do sloupce Hotovo.

    A screenshot of Azure Boards, showing the card in the Done column.

Zakázání kanálu nebo odstranění projektu

Každý modul v tomto studijním programu poskytuje šablonu. Šablonu můžete spustit a vytvořit pro modul čisté prostředí.

Spuštění více šablon poskytuje několik projektů Azure Pipelines. Každý projekt odkazuje na stejné úložiště GitHub. Toto nastavení může aktivovat několik kanálů, které se budou spouštět při každém nasdílení změn do úložiště GitHub. Kanál běží s využitím bezplatných minut sestavení na našich hostovaných agentech. Pokud se chcete vyhnout ztrátě těchto minut bezplatného sestavení, zakažte nebo odstraňte kanál před přechodem na další modul.

Zvolte jednu z následujících možností.

Možnost 1: Zakázání kanálu

Zakažte kanál tak, aby nezpracovál požadavky na sestavení. Pokud budete chtít, můžete kanál buildu později znovu povolit. Tuto možnost zvolte, pokud chcete daný projekt DevOps a kanál buildu zachovat pro budoucí použití.

Zakázání kanálu:

  1. V Azure Pipelines přejděte ke svému kanálu.

  2. V rozevírací nabídce vyberte Nastavení:

    A screenshot of Azure Pipelines showing the location of the Settings menu.

  3. V části Zpracovánínovýchch

    Kanál nebude požadavky na sestavení dále zpracovávat.

Možnost 2: Odstranění projektu Azure DevOps

Odstraňte projekt Azure DevOps, včetně obsahu Azure Boards a kanálu buildu. V budoucíchmodulech Tuto možnost zvolte, pokud nepotřebujete svůj projekt DevOps pro budoucí použití.

Odstranění projektu:

  1. V Azure DevOps přejděte do svého projektu. Dříve doporučujeme pojmenovat tento projekt Space Game – web – Azure Functions.

  2. V dolním rohu vyberte Project settings (Nastavení projektu).

  3. V oblasti Přehled přejděte do dolní části a vyberte Odstranit.

    A screenshot of Azure Pipelines showing the location of the Delete button.

  4. V zobrazeném okně zadejte název projektu. Znovu vyberte Odstranit .

    Váš projekt je teď odstraněný.